Transaction 337a6330b577317205822f90907ac0d6ed07571ee1910b7614d2779888be913d
1 Input
1 Output
-
337a6330b577317205822f90907ac0d6ed07571ee1910b7614d2779888be913d:0
- value
- 601405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ec763c32e64ea4ccc758cace8539d94313c68e64 OP_EQUAL
- address
- 3PFK2wMzYwjWKwx6y74uTpn6EEXhfMSzhT